  10. thanks man. ya, i the W126 models come in ranges like 280s etc.... the 124e and the E-class are actually a bit diferent.. though they loook almost alike, there's a difernce in the lights, grill and some parts... One reason my friend’s looking for a 126 is that those cars really don’t depreciate like Japanese cars or some other European cars.. and Mercs (even the older ones) are pretty dam solid vehicles… even the 123 he has right now is quite a drive… bit on the slow side when it comes to acceleration, but when it comes to driving long distance it is amazing… I’ve driven the car to the katunayaka and back a couple of times… effortless drive.. And the 126 has a very majestic look… I haven’t driven one yet, but cant wait till I do…
